﻿.xtreme-push-item, .xtreme-push-item__show-more
{
    cursor: pointer;
    display: flex;
    flex-direction: row;
    justify-content: space-between;
    padding: 16px 0;
}
.xtreme-push-item__card
{
    flex-direction: column;
    padding-top: 0;
}
.xtreme-push-item__card .xtreme-push-item__left .xtreme-push-item__icon
{
    padding: 0;
}
.xtreme-push-item__card .xtreme-push-item__left .xtreme-push-item__icon img
{
    height: auto;
    margin-bottom: 16px;
    width: 100%;
}
.xtreme-push-item__card .xtreme-push-item__middle, .xtreme-push-item__card .xtreme-push-item__right
{
    padding: 0 24px;
}
.xtreme-push-item__left, .xtreme-push-item__middle, .xtreme-push-item__right
{
    display: flex;
}
.xtreme-push-item p
{
    margin: 0;
}
.xtreme-push-item__middle
{
    flex: 1 1 auto;
    flex-direction: column;
    font-size: 14px;
    padding-right: 24px;
}
.xtreme-push-item__middle--inner
{
    display: flex;
    justify-content: space-between;
}
.xtreme-push-item__right
{
    display: flex;
    flex: none;
    margin-left: 8px;
    margin-right: 24px;
    width: 40px;
}
.xtreme-push-item__icon
{
    align-items: center;
    display: flex;
    padding: 0 24px;
}
.xtreme-push-item__icon .xtreme-push-item__placeholder, .xtreme-push-item__icon img
{
    height: 48px;
    width: 48px;
}
.xtreme-push-item__alert, .xtreme-push-item__date, .xtreme-push-item__title
{
    line-height: 24px;
}
.xtreme-push-item__date
{
    font-size: 12px;
    opacity: .8;
    text-align: right;
}
.xtreme-push-item__alert
{
    font-size: 14px;
    font-weight: 400;
    opacity: .8;
}
.xtreme-push-item__title
{
    font-size: 16px;
    font-weight: 600;
}
.xtreme-push-trigger
{
    background-color: #ff0098;
    background-image: url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 226 213"><path d="M16 163.6v-111c.6 1 1.7 2.1 3.3 3.2L90.2 108l-70.9 52.2c-1.6 1.3-2.7 2.4-3.3 3.4zM208.3 55.9l-70.9 52.2 70.9 52.2c1.6 1.1 2.6 2.2 3.3 3.2V52.6c-.7 1-1.8 2.1-3.3 3.3zM207 166l-73.6-54.3s-8.8 7.4-19.6 7.4c-10.4 0-19.6-7.4-19.6-7.4L20.5 166c-6.1 4.5-4.8 8.2 2.9 8.2h180.7c7.8 0 9.1-3.7 2.9-8.2zm-104.2-56c6 4.4 15.8 4.4 21.8 0L205 51.3c6-4.4 4.7-8-2.9-8H25.3c-7.6 0-8.9 3.6-2.9 8l80.4 58.7z" fill-rule="evenodd" clip-rule="evenodd" fill="%23fff"/></svg>');
    background-position: 50%;
    background-repeat: no-repeat;
    background-size: 24px 24px;
    border-radius: 100%;
    bottom: 20px;
    box-shadow: 0 0 6px #ff0098;
    cursor: pointer;
    display: flex;
    height: 65px;
    left: 20px;
    line-height: 65px;
    position: fixed;
    text-align: center;
    transition: background-color .25s ease-in-out;
    width: 65px;
    z-index: 9999999;
}
.xtreme-push-trigger:hover
{
    background-color: #ff33ad;
}
.xtreme-push-trigger__number
{
    border-radius: 20px;
    color: #fff!important;
    font-size: 13px;
    line-height: 9px;
    padding: 3px 8px;
    position: absolute;
    transform: translateX(-50%);
}
.xtreme-push-trigger[data-position=bottom-left]
{
    bottom: 20px;
    left: 20px;
}
.xtreme-push-trigger[data-position=top-left]
{
    bottom: auto;
    left: 20px;
    right: auto;
    top: 20px;
}
.xtreme-push-trigger[data-position=bottom-right]
{
    background-color: #000;
    box-shadow: none;
    display: inline-flex;
    height: 20px;
    left: 0;
    position: relative;
    top: 0;
}
.xtreme-push-trigger[data-position=top-right]
{
    bottom: auto;
    left: auto;
    right: 20px;
    top: 20px;
}
.xtreme-push-trigger[data-position=top-left] .xtreme-push-trigger__number, .xtreme-push-trigger[data-position=top-right] .xtreme-push-trigger__number
{
    bottom: -10px;
}
.xtreme-push-trigger[data-position=bottom-left] .xtreme-push-trigger__number, .xtreme-push-trigger[data-position=bottom-right] .xtreme-push-trigger__number
{
    right: 6px;
    top: -10px;
}
.xtreme-push-trigger__burger-indictor
{
    background-color: #000;
    border-radius: 100%;
    height: 5px;
    position: absolute;
    right: -5px;
    top: -5px;
    width: 5px;
}
#webpush-notification-center
{
    width: 450px!important;
    z-index: 99999999;
}
.webpush-notification-center-item
{
    transition: background .25s ease-in-out;
}
#webpush-notification-center #webpush-notification-center-header
{
    background-color: #ff0098;
    border-bottom-width: 0;
}
#webpush-notification-center #webpush-notification-center-header #webpush-notification-center-title
{
    font-size: 16px;
    letter-spacing: normal;
}
#webpush-notification-center.webpush-notification-center-color-dark
{
    background: #2f2f31;
    box-shadow: 0 0 6px #2f2f31;
}
#webpush-notification-center #webpush-notification-center-icon
{
    display: none;
}
.xtreme-push-item__show-more
{
    justify-content: center;
}
.xtreme-push-item__show-more span
{
    margin-right: 8px;
}
.xtreme-push-item__chevron
{
    fill: #fff;
    height: 16px;
    width: 16px;
}
.xtreme-push-indicator
{
    background-color: #ff0098;
    border-radius: 100%!important;
    height: 10px!important;
    position: absolute!important;
    top: 0!important;
    width: 10px!important;
}
.xtreme-push-trigger__mobile-menu span
{
    position: relative;
}
.xtreme-push-trigger__number[data-value]:not([data-value=""]):after
{
    background-color: #ff0098;
    border-radius: 100%;
    color: #fff;
    content: attr(data-value);
    font-size: 13px;
    padding: 5px 6px;
    position: absolute;
    right: -5px;
    top: 0;
}
.xtreme-push-trigger__mobile-menu .xtreme-push-trigger__number
{
    position: absolute;
    right: 0;
}